HIGHLANDS RANCH, Colo. (KKTV) - At about 2 p.m. the Douglas County Sheriff's Office put out an alert tied to a shooting at a school.

The shooting happened at the STEM school at Ridgeline and Plaza in Highlands Ranch. Authorities asked the public to avoid the area. It isn't clear if anyone is injured, but the sheriff's office said this is an "unstable situation."

At least two people were shot according to authorities.

This article will be updated as more information becomes available.

 Two suspects are in custody after multiple victims were shot at a Colorado school, a law enforcement source told ABC News.

Authorities are currently engaging a third suspect, the source said.

The Douglas County Sheriff's Office received reports that shots were fired at the STEM School in Highlands Ranch just before 2 p.m., according to a tweet. At least two people are believed to be injured, according to the sheriff's office.
